Senior Project Planner/Scheduler Job Description
The Senior Project Planner/Scheduler will be responsible for developing, overseeing and maintaining project schedules within the site P6 database for the full EPCM and CQV scope of a large CAPEX project.
* Developing working schedules from project concept to production start is a key aspect of this role.
* Creating and integrating schedules, managing workflows and generating progress reports and metrics for management is also a crucial responsibility.
* Development and management of resource loaded schedules in P6, interacting with different stakeholders to ensure resource demand is accurately reflected, is another key duty.
Responsibilities:
* This position involves end-to-end schedule development and management of all schedule aspects of a project from design through to manufacture, including design, construction, commissioning and qualification.
* Project controls management, including baseline schedule development and management, performance status and reporting, baseline change control, risk management, earned value management is a significant part of this role.
* Supporting the development of integrated master schedules for specific programmes in Primavera P6 that reflect all interface milestones and activity durations from multiple schedules is another key responsibility.
* Management of a schedule portfolio of projects, both large capital project and core business project schedules, is also required.
* Generating progress reports for Project Managers is an essential task.
* Summarising individual contractor programmes into overall project schedules is a critical function.
* High level resource loading of schedules to produce progress measure reports is necessary.
* High level resource loading of Owners resources demand to support the delivery of capital projects is also required.
* Generating and communicating schedule recovery plans where necessary is an important task.
* Chairing schedule workshops with cross-functional teams is a vital function.
* Ability to review and integrate detailed design, contracts, construction and commissioning programmes is essential.
* Development of commissioning programmes with commissioning team is another key responsibility.
* Attending weekly contractor meetings across various projects is necessary.
* Developing working relationships with line managers and individuals within each functional group utilizing open communication skills is essential.
